dwmbar 使用教程
dwmbarA Modular Status Bar for dwm.项目地址:https://gitcode.com/gh_mirrors/dw/dwmbar
1、项目介绍
dwmbar
是一个为 dwm
设计的模块化状态栏。它通过设置根窗口名称来显示状态信息,支持自定义模块和配置。该项目虽然不再活跃维护,但用户可以通过联系开发者或 fork 项目来进行自定义改进。
2、项目快速启动
安装依赖
在开始之前,确保你已经安装了必要的依赖,特别是 dwm
和 bash
。
克隆项目
git clone https://github.com/thytom/dwmbar.git
cd dwmbar
安装
运行安装脚本:
sudo ./install.sh
配置
编辑 ~/.config/dwmbar/dwmbarrc
文件,添加你需要的模块:
MODULES="mpd volumebar wifi battery"
启动
在 xinitrc
文件中添加以下行以在启动时运行 dwmbar
:
dwmbar &
3、应用案例和最佳实践
自定义模块
你可以创建自定义模块并将其添加到 MODULES
变量中。模块默认位于 /usr/share/dwmbar/modules
,你可以在此目录下创建新的模块脚本。
最佳实践
- 模块顺序:根据你的使用习惯调整模块的顺序。
- 分隔符:通过修改
SEPARATOR
变量来调整模块之间的分隔符。 - 填充:使用
PADDING
变量来调整状态栏的填充和位置。
4、典型生态项目
相关项目
- dwm:动态窗口管理器,
dwmbar
的主要运行环境。 - st:简单的终端,常与
dwm
一起使用。 - dmenu:动态菜单,用于快速启动应用程序。
通过这些项目的结合使用,可以构建一个高效且个性化的工作环境。
dwmbarA Modular Status Bar for dwm.项目地址:https://gitcode.com/gh_mirrors/dw/dwmbar